Thank you for your interest in being a part of the Deaf & hard of hearing community committee for the 2023 festival. 

We have been working with a Deaf consultant for a number of years now but we want more Deaf and hard of hearing people involved.

Who can apply?
Anyone who is Deaf, deaf or hard of hearing, enjoys going to performances and lives in or near Vancouver. 

Until when?
October 11th

What will the committee do?
We will have a meeting on October 18th or 19th in person in downtown Vancouver. 
If possible we might also be able to have people join on zoom.
At the meeting you will:
  • decide which show(s) will have ASL-interpretation
  • decide which show(s) will have captions
  • share ideas on who in the local Deaf community should see the shows and how we can reach out to them 
How do we choose the people?
We work with the Deaf consultant to choose 7-10 people.

Will you be paid?
Yes you will be paid $50 and 2 tickets to the festival.
If it is easier we can give you a $50 gift card for a supermarket.
